The Prime Minister Imran Khan has urged the international community to stop India from its reckless and militarist agenda before the Modi government’s brinkmanship pushes the region into a conflict it cannot afford.

According to details, the Prime Minister has stated this on social networking webiste Twitter on Monday. He reiterated the commitment to continue to expose India’s belligerent designs towards Pakistan and fascism of Modi’s government.

In a series of tweets, he regretted that the Prime Minister Narendra Modi continues to turn India into a rogue state.

Imran Khan further stated that the Indian sponsorship of terrorism in Pakistan, its abuses in illegally occupied Jammu and Kashmir and a fifteen year global disinformation campaign against us stand exposed.

“India’s own media now has revealed the dirty nexus that is pushing our nuclearized region to the brink of a conflict,” he added.

The Premier also refferred to his address to the United Nations General Assembly (UNGA) in 2019 as to how India’s fascist Modi government used the Balakot crisis for domestic electoral gains. He said latest revelations from communication of an Indian journalist, known for his warmongering, reveal the unholy nexus between the Modi government and the Indian media that led to a dangerous military adventurism to win an election in utter disregard for the consequences of destabilizing the entire region.

“Pakistan averted a larger crisis by a responsible and measured response to Balakot,” he added.
